Time Management Techniques to Live By

Planning Ahead

One of the best ways to start managing your time better is by planning ahead. Taking a few minutes at the end of each day to jot down your top priorities for the next can be incredibly effective.

  • Use tools like planners, apps, or simple to-do lists.
  • Identify the three most important tasks each day.

Setting SMART Goals

Ever heard of SMART goals? These are spec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ound objectives that give structure and purpose to your activities.

Prioritization is Key

It’s tempting to tackle easy tasks first, but prioritization ensures you're working on what truly matters.

  • Use the Eisenhower Box to differentiate urgent from important tasks.
  • Consider the potential impact of completing (or not completing) tasks.

Embracing Flexibility

While structure is important, so is flexibility. Life is unpredictable, and sometimes we need to adapt on the fly. Allow room in your schedule for unexpected, last-minute changes.

Remember, the goal is not to pack your day but to balance productivity with breathing space.
